Host Lineage: Kytococcus sedentarius; Kytococcus; Dermacoccaceae; Actinomycetales; Actinobacteria; Bacteria

General Information: Country: USA; Temp: Mesophile; Temp: 28 - 36C; Habitat: Marine, Skin microflora. Strain DSM 20547, the type strain, is a free-living, nonmotile, Gram-positive bacterium, originally isolated from a marine environment in about 1944. It grows as spherical/coccoid and occurs predominantly in tetrads which can be arranged in cubical packets. It is non-encapsulated and does not form endospores, is strictly aerobic and chemoorganotrophic, requires methionine and other amino acids for growth, and grows well in NaCl at concentrations up to 10% (w/v). This organism is a normal commensal of human skin, however has been implicated in pitted keratolysis, pneumonia, and other opportunistic infections.
